Neck pain/back pain
For the last few months i was having neck pain, back pain, hips pain. The pain is really severe during sleep and on waking up. Got myself tested and x ray showed evidence of straightening of spinal curvature, straightening of cervical lordosis and fusion of C2 and c3 vertebral bodies. Apart from this HLAB27 is detected. Doctor said that this disease is progressive and can't be cured. She advised to keep exercising, swimming, yoga etc. Can things be so worse in future that i won't be able to live a normal life?
